.pomo museum to open in trondheim, norway Position on 15 February 2025, PoMo is actually a brand-new gallery in Trondheim, Norway, that will certainly take international modern and also contemporary art to the coastal city with a permanent compilation and also an evolving system of short-term exhibitions. Her very first museum task, architect as well as professional India Mahdavi will thoughfully improve Trondheim's Art Nouveau Post Office creating right into a 4,000 square meters brand new site over five floors, in collaboration with Norwegian engineer Erik Langdalen. PoMo will open with a team exhibit labelled 'Mails from the Future', working February 15th-- June 22nd, 2025. The museum is going to display its own selection with permanent screens and pair of big yearly events, consisting of solo discussions and also particular studies. Guest managers are going to work together along with PoMo's team to bring new viewpoints, as well as a worldwide loan course are going to bring up partnership. Celebrations and also talks will definitely contextualize the exhibits, and an education system are going to engage children, youth, as well as grownups, with collaborations intended with research establishments as well as universities.Ugo Rondinone, our magic hour, 2003. Entrusted with developing a perspective for the gallery in alliance along with architect Erik Langdalen, Mahdavi has actually administered her trademark method to enhance the famous building, integrated in 1911, in to a contemporary space. PoMo will definitely consist of 3 storeys of event exhibits, to house both temporary exhibits and permanent assortment display screens a fluid as well as welcoming entry room created to malfunction obstacles in between street, gallery as well as artworks flexible basement areas committed to celebrations and education and learning a library and study area in the eaves of the property and also a reception space as well as office space on the attic. Pulling creativity coming from Trondheim's cityscape and past history, along with Norwegian folk art and craftsmanship, and also the tradition of the old post office property, India Mahdavi has created a vibrant as well as cheerful restoration that commemorates in-between places as high as exhibition rooms: vibrant, vibrant moments will certainly punctuate PoMo from the cellar to the fourth floor, typically activated by art work from the long-term compilation. Sustainability is at the forefront of Langdalen's approach, paying attention to the rehab and also re-use of historic and pre-existing buildings in order to lessen greenhouse fuel discharges, produce historic anchoring and also increase social dedication. The India Mahdavi-designed PoMo will definitely launch along with Mails from the Future, a group event featuring approximately one hundred jobs by 24 global performers coming from its own brand new long-lasting selection and also considerable global loans. Reaching all 3 show floorings, the series draws creativity from the property's past as Trondheim's previous main General post office, utilizing the mail as a particular allegory. Like artworks, postcards serve as vessels for public as well as personal storytelling. The exhibit will certainly consist of parts coming from the PoMo Assortment along with significant jobs through performers such as Fischli &amp Weiss, Isa Genzken, Matthew Angelo Harrison, Catherine Opie, Giovanni Battista Piranesi, Susan Rothenberg, Andy Warhol, as well as Monira Al Qadiri. The PoMo Selection, triggered by Monica and also Ole Robert Reitan as well as featuring arts pieces from REITAN's compilation, focuses on range, originality, and worldwide portrayal. To resolve gender disparity in museum collections, at the very least 60% of its acquisitions are devoted to women artists.
